Understanding the Mechanics of Crash Games

At its heart, a crash game operates on a provably fair system, meaning the outcome of each round is not predetermined and can be verified by the player. This transparency is crucial for building trust and ensuring a fair gaming experience. Typically, a seed value is generated by the server and another by the player. These seeds are combined to determine the crash point. The use of cryptographic algorithms ensures that neither the player nor the operator can manipulate the outcome. This builds trust and prevents any accusations of foul play a critical factor in the popularity of these games. Beyond the fairness aspect, understanding the random number generator (RNG) is vital to grasp the unpredictable nature of the gameplay. While you can’t predict exactly when the crash will occur, understanding the mechanics behind it allows for a more informed approach.

Managing Your Bankroll Effectively

Effective bankroll management is arguably the most crucial aspect of successful crash game play. It involves carefully allocating your funds to ensure you can withstand losing streaks and capitalize on winning opportunities. A common rule of thumb is to allocate only a small percentage of your bankroll to each bet – typically between 1% and 5%. This ensures that even a series of losses won’t deplete your funds. Additionally, it’s vital to avoid chasing losses by increasing your bet size in an attempt to recover them quickly. This can quickly lead to a downward spiral. Instead, focus on consistent, disciplined betting and adhere to your predetermined strategy. Remember that patience is key; crash games are a marathon, not a sprint.

Understanding Variance and Risk Tolerance

Variance, in the context of crash games, refers to the degree of fluctuation in your results. High variance means you can experience significant swings in your bankroll, while low variance indicates more consistent, albeit smaller, wins and losses. Understanding your risk tolerance – your ability to handle potential losses – is critical for determining your betting strategy. If you’re risk-averse, you should opt for lower multipliers and smaller bets. If you’re comfortable with higher risk, you can explore higher multipliers and larger bets, but be prepared for the possibility of significant losses. Aligning your strategy with your risk tolerance is paramount for a sustainable and enjoyable gaming experience. One must know when to walk away.
